Mac M4 Pro Chip Release Date

It is anticipated that the Mac M4 Pro chip will be available in October 2024. Gurman revealed an Apple roadmap back in April of this year, which indicates that the M4 Pro processor would receive an update around the end of 2024 and the beginning of 2025, appearing in the more expensive MacBook Pros, Mac minis, and the next iPad 11th generation.

The Mac M4 Pro chip launch date, however, may be closer than anticipated and may occur in a few weeks, according to Gurman’s newsletter from September of this year.

In a late-August tweet, he said that Apple will undoubtedly follow usual practice and wait to unveil the gadgets until they are ready for delivery.

Although all of these Mac M4 Pro chip speculations suggest an October release date, we will have to wait till Apple makes an official announcement in the upcoming weeks.

Mac M4 Pro Chip Specs

Although the Mac M4 Pro’s CPU and GPU upgrades remain unknown, Apple will want to clear the way for the sophisticated Apple Intelligence capabilities that the corporation is using to promote its next product lines.

M4 Pro Chip Advancements

To put things in perspective, the present M3 Pro chip has a maximum of 12 cores for the CPU and up to 18 cores for the GPU. If these parameters are improved in the Mac M4 Pro, the core numbers will exceed those benchmarks.

More than 40 billion transistors may be included in the Mac M4 Pro chip, compared to the Mac M3 Pro’s 37 billion transistors. Similar to the normal M4 chip type, these transistors might be constructed with a second-generation 3-nanometer technology, increasing Apple silicon’s power efficiency even more.

16-core Neural Engine

The Mac M4 Pro chip’s NPU core will probably stay 16 cores, much like the normal edition. With an enhanced 16-core Neural Engine, Apple’s most potent Neural Engine can do up to 38 trillion operations per second (TOPS), which is around 60 times quicker than the original Neural Engine found in the A11 Bionic.

The Mac M4 chip’s Neural Engine will be extremely potent for AI workloads in addition to next-generation machine learning (ML) accelerators in the processor, a powerful GPU, and higher-bandwidth unified memory.
